we investigate experimentally the phenomenon of intra-envelope four-wave mixing in optical fibers. This phenomenon arises when two lasers, having nearly identical central frequencies, interact by four wave mixing process with each other. As a result, new spectral components are created within the existing spectra. We successfully isolate these components using a third laser through a multi-heterodyne detection process.
